Output 89d0d62c8af46d3dd766620c1bc7224a913a2fd97c2fdd4ad8681eb7940ff069:3

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a8a1140be10d3fe23fab375a4fbda042578cae OP_EQUAL
address
36Db3WL9ZPxBa5YCoUrw9tTrcY65HbdxSx
transaction
89d0d62c8af46d3dd766620c1bc7224a913a2fd97c2fdd4ad8681eb7940ff069
spent
true